The Manufacturing Operator IV operate machine(s) as defined in the Machine Operator Manual and following all safety procedures. Perform simple changeover and set up. Load supplies and make adjustments to semi‑automated machine(s). Machine operator is responsible for ensuring the machine works properly, utilizing the correct materials for the product and keeping the equipment running. The Operator must demonstrate a detailed understanding of the quality requirements for the products being produced and be able to make adjustments as necessary to achieve maximum quality. In addition is responsible for troubleshooting equipment effectively and appropriately seeking assistance of a trained mechanic. When necessary clearly communicating equipment problems to the mechanic and asking questions if necessary. Reports any problem with the equipment or supplies to their supervisor or team leader. These positions have a direct effect on the quality of our products. This role may be used as a training prerequisite for a higher‑level Machine Operator position.
This job has no supervisory responsibilities.

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is required to stand for extended periods, perform manual dexterity activities and l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.
The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is exposed to moving mechanical parts. The employee may be exposed to wet and/or humid conditions. Employee may be required to move material in and out of freezers. May work near equipment that generates heat.
